Lithium: past, present, and future.

Treatment guidelines recommend lithium as a first-line option for relapse prevention and suicide prevention in bipolar I disorder. However, there is a disparity between research efficacy and clinical effectiveness, with only a third of patients having an excellent response to long-term treatment. Nowadays, lithium use is in decline, which is probably influenced by the predominance of sub-optimal responses, the need for blood monitoring, the perception that lithium is more toxic than other medications, and the often lengthy trials necessary to determine response.
